Best late-night dining: Raku
Thu, May 26, 2011 (midnight)
Photo: Beverly Poppe
Great at any hour, after midnight the place is packed with those ready to worship at the altar of Chef Mitsuo Endo. It’s the best time to try something crazy, like charcoal grilled beef tendon or a bowl of sea urchin with poached egg and salmon roe. 5030 W. Spring Mountain Road. Mon.-Sat., 6 p.m.-3 a.m. 367-3511.
